Cell phone with analog clock is not a good idea

toshiba drape

We keep moving forward with technology, but some people just can't let go of the past. Nostalgia is all well and good, but sometimes we need to leave our cutting-edge tech and our love of retro as far away from each other as possible.

Case in point: this silly phone from the far east that looks like your standard-issue tacky bronze clamshell until you open it. Then — whaa? An analog clock? But… why? The Toshiba Drape has other high-tech fixins, such as a 3-megapixel digital camera, but stuff like text messaging and mobile web functionality are lacking due to the, you know, missing screen. But hey, you can see what time it is! Oh, well I guess you can do that with every other phone ever made as well. Huh. Well, the chances of a phone like this, with its main feature being a lack of a feature, making it to the states are slim, so you probably won't get a chance to be perplexed by this thing in person.
